Caring Bunny, the largest program of its kind, has been developed by Simon and is guided by AbilityPath.org, a national online resource hub and special needs community. Over 90 Simon® properties will host the Caring Bunny this season and Autism Speaks is providing promotional assistance. Many steps will be taken to reduce sensory triggers, creating a more comforting environment for children’s cherished visit with the Bunny. The subdued environment is likely to include:

  • Turning off in-mall music and dimming the lights for the duration of the event.
  • Eliminating queue lines through the use of a numbering system.
  • Special activities during the ‘wait’ period to help the child understand what activities will occur during the visit.
